Eligibility
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: Willingness to participate in the study Normal BMI Absence of underlying disease
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: Unwillingness to participate in the study Use of hormonal drugs containing estrogen and progesterone in the last three months drug use BMI greater than 40 irregular bleeding within 1 year after menopause hysterectomy uncontrolled blood pressure thyroid diseases diabetes mellitus history of hormone related cancers
Design outcomes
Primary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| Investigating the hot flush symptoms based on the patients' answers (the criteria of a questionnaire designed with three states of mild, moderate and severe). Timepoint: 12weeks. Method of measurement: In the first visit, for those eligible to enter the study, they were asked to fill out the form related to severity (mild: sudden hot flush, moderate: sudden hot flush with severe sweating, severe: sudden hot flush with Sweating and interference with daily activities), the number of hot flashes (within a week), should be completed weekly from one week before the treatment to 12 weeks after the treatment and delivered at each visit.In case of not being able to visit these people in person, information will be collected on a weekly basis and during phone calls. Medicines were delivered to people in the clinic during three stages at the beginning of the treatment, the end of the 4th week and the end of the 8th week. | — |
